The Nuclear Testing Saga

In a stirring move, President Trump announced plans to resume nuclear weapons testing, suggesting that the U.S. needs to catch up with global competitors like Russia and China. Despite a historical moratorium, Trump’s stance underscores a shift towards a more assertive nuclear posture. According to CBS News, this strategic pivot echoes his broader focus on national security and defense readiness.

The Government Shutdown Standstill

As the country grapples with one of its longest government shutdowns, Trump placed blame squarely on the Democrats, pushing for a resolution through congressional votes. The impasse, primarily fueled by disputes over healthcare subsidies, reflects the deep political divisions that define his presidency.

Having just returned from a pivotal meeting with Xi Jinping, President Trump hailed a temporary truce in the trade war, pointing to lower tariffs and resumed agricultural trade as major wins. Despite facing criticism for his tariff strategy, Trump remains confident, stating that the economic advantages outweigh the temporary pains experienced by sectors like soybean farming.

Immigration: A Continuing Controversy

Trump’s immigration policy remains as steadfast as ever, focusing on deportation and border security. While critics point out the harshness of raids and deportations, Trump defends his methods as necessary measures against threats from undocumented immigrants. His recent deployment of the National Guard to several major cities underscores his unwavering commitment to crack down on crime linked to immigration.

Global Diplomacy: Balancing Acts

In a discussion about geopolitical players, Trump described both Putin and Xi as formidable leaders who command seriousness and respect. While his relations with Russia draw scrutiny, Trump emphasized the shared interests between global superpowers, suggesting that economic partnerships could drive future diplomacy.
